Job Duties

  • Owns, leads and oversees daily pastry shop operations, fiscal budgets, labor productivity, scheduling, inventory control, guest service standards, and execution and development of menu strategies to produce both short-term and long-term profitability
  • Represents the pastry shop in divisional, property or corporate meetings
  • Responsible for execution of policies, operating procedures, pricing initiatives, training programs, directives, menus, rules and regulations for the pastry staff
  • Owns department execution of F&B and/or companywide initiatives and programs
  • Maintains the highest standards of health, sanitation and cleanliness within all areas of the kitchen
  • Responsible for completion of all company compliance training for staff
  • Manages Human Resources responsibilities to include: creating a work environment that promotes teamwork, performance feedback (coaching and counseling), recognition, mutual respect and employee satisfaction
  • quality hiring, training and succession planning process that encompass the companys diversity commitment
  • adherence to the companys status quo third-party representation philosophy
  • compliance with company policies, legal requirements, employment law, and collective bargaining agreements
  • Interacts with internal/external guests to ensure satisfaction and product quality
  • Reviews BEOs, SEOs and MEOs daily to ensure that orders executed upon
  • Reacts to any feedback on guest complaints and takes any appropriate action
  • Collaborates with divisional Directors, Executive Chefs, and pastry team to ensure a seamless execution of product delivery between kitchens inclusive of time standards, recipe specifications, and quality
  • Maintains excellent knowledge of propertys food & beverage products, menu items and equipment used to perform duties
